Paper is one of the most ubiquitous of all media, and it’s also frequently discounted in the fine arts and elsewhere. Yet artists have been drawing and painting on paper – and using it as a creative medium – since its invention in China more than 2,200 years ago.

Join CMATO for a virtual discussion with artist Karen Sikie, one of several exhibiting artists in CMATO's international juried exhibition, Defining Beauty. Sikie's work with decorative papers led her to develop a highly specialized and precise form of collage called paper mosaic that pieces together an image with hand-cut papers, using shape to define form.

Sikie will discuss her process-driven approach to collage, the history of the medium and new works.
